Discovery Museum is a hands-on museum for families that blends science, nature, and play.
The all-new Discovery Museum opened in March 2018! Come explore re-imagined exhibits -- and many new ones -- from both original museums, now combined into one beautiful and accessible space for all ages to play, explore, and learn together. There are intimate, immersive experiences for the youngest learners and new galleries of STEAM experiences for all ages, including water, light and color, sound, making and creating, math, and a 14-foot interactive air maze.
The museum has been honored with a 2018 John F. Kennedy Center for the Performing Arts LEAD® Community Asset Award; named Boston Magazine's 2018 Best of Boston(R), Best Family-Friendly Museum, West; Gold, Best Museum, 2018 Wicked Local Reader's Choice Awards; and "Best of the Best" in the 2018 Boston Parents Paper Family Favorites awards.
Admission includes access to both the museum and the Discovery Woods outdoor nature playscape, with a wiggly bridge, rain garden, cargo net climb, nest swing, and 550sf treehouse abutting 180 acres of conservation land.
All exhibits are hands-on, low-tech, open-ended, and interactive, to encourage play and exploration, and the entire campus and exhibits are accessible. Come play and learn together.
